Title
Test Driven Development of Web Applications: A Lightweight Approach
Abstract
The difficulty of creating a test suite before developing a web application is the main barrier to the adoption of the Acceptance Test Driven Development (ATDD) paradigm. In this work, we present a general lightweight approach and a specific instantiation based on existing tools for acceptance test driven development of web applications. The idea, which is the basis of our approach, is simple: using a capture/replay tool able to generate test scripts on previously created Screen Mockups of the web application to develop. These test scripts can be later executed against the web application, and used to drive its development following the requirements in ATDD mode. The presented approach has been used to re-develop the main features of an open-source web application. Observations, limitations of the approach, and lessons learnt are outlined.
Year
DOI
Venue
2016
10.1109/QUATIC.2016.014
2016 10th International Conference on the Quality of Information and Communications Technology (QUATIC)
Keywords
Field
DocType
ATDD paradigm,Screen Mockups,Capture/Replay tools
Test suite,Test Management Approach,Systems engineering,Test-driven development,Computer science,Test script,Robustness (computer science),Web modeling,Web application
Conference
ISBN
Citations 
PageRank 
978-1-5090-3582-3
0
0.34
References 
Authors
18
4
Name
Order
Citations
PageRank
Diego Clerissi1708.58
Maurizio Leotta226232.08
Gianna Reggio380086.77
Filippo Ricca41788124.62